
Downtown Napa is hosting the inaugural
Napa Valley StreamFest, taking place April 24 to 27. This event will bring together a lineup of Hollywood talent, including actors, filmmakers, and podcasters. The festival will feature panels, screenings, and discussions, transforming Downtown Napa into a hub for streaming art. Notable attendees include
Jason Segel, who will discuss his Apple TV+ show “Shrinking,” and
Judith Light, who will be honored for her career achievements. Additionally,
Diane Warren will receive the StreamFest Visionary Tribute Award for her prolific songwriting career.
The festival will also highlight emerging artists and athletes, featuring panels with breakthrough creators like Katie Cassidy and Megan Scott, moderated by Rochelle Rose. Former NBA stars Baron Davis and Russell R.J. will discuss their post-sports careers in a dynamic conversation. The event promises a diverse range of programming, celebrating the art of storytelling in the streaming age and engaging the local community.
